EXAS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2024 in Review

627 of the 6,945 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Exact Sciences (EXAS) for Q1 2024, worth a combined $11.3B — down 5.6% from $12B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 88 funds closed out of EXAS and 73 opened new positions — a net loss of 15 holders — while 204 trimmed existing stakes and 230 added.

The largest buyer was Capital World Investors, adding an estimated $352M. The largest seller was JP Morgan Chase, cutting an estimated $272M.
